This client is an e-commerce business selling camper and van conversion accessories, including interior fittings, travel equipment, and van lifestyle essentials.
Prior to working with DigitInk, the brand was managing both Google Ads and Meta Ads internally. While campaigns were generating sales, performance was unstable, and the Return on Ad Spend (ROAS) was not high enough to confidently scale advertising budgets.
Complicating the situation further, due to a required currency migration in Google Ads, the business had to create a completely new Google Ads account. This meant:
- No historical optimization data
- No previous learning phase signals
- No campaign performance history
- A full Google Ads rebuild from zero
DigitInk stepped in to restructure the entire paid acquisition system, focusing on profitability, stability, and scalable growth.

What is Performance Max Optimization?
Performance Max is a goal-based Google Ads campaign type that uses machine learning to serve ads across multiple Google placements, including Search, Shopping, Display, YouTube, and Discover.
Optimization involves:
Structuring asset groups strategically
Prioritizing high-margin products
Refining audience signals
Improving product feed quality
Guiding budget allocation
In e-commerce environments, Performance Max is especially effective for balancing demand capture and conversion efficiency.

What happens when rebuilding a Google Ads Account?
Rebuilding a Google Ads account removes prior machine learning signals, audience data, and optimization history.
To accelerate performance recovery:
- Conversion tracking must be precise
- Campaign structure must be intentional
- High-value products should be prioritized
- Budget allocation must guide learning

The Funnel Structure
DigitInk implemented a full paid acquisition funnel designed for both demand creation and demand capture.
Top of Funnel (TOF)
- Meta dynamic catalog ads targeting broad audiences
- Google Performance Max capturing high-intent traffic
Middle of Funnel (MOF)
- Meta remarketing campaigns for engaged users
- Google Performance Max leveraging behavioral signals
Bottom of Funnel (BOF)
- Meta dynamic remarketing for cart abandoners
- Google Performance Max prioritizing high-margin products
This alignment ensured both platforms worked together to maximize conversion efficiency and profitability.
